Amos Guiora, Professor of Law at the University of Utah S.J. Quinney College of Law, was quoted in an April 8, 2105 Vice News article, “Police in India Now Have Drones That Can Shower Unruly Crowds with Pepper Spray.”
In response to concerns about the protection of civil liberties and the risks inherent in remote pilots targeting a crowd from a position of remove, Guoira said, “I’m very much an advocate of hands-on decision making. By hands-on, I mean a human being — as a human being, not some damn machine. Drone operators with feet up on their desk. That’s what worries me.”
